Iran war updates: Trump baulks at truce as attacks hammer Israel and Gulf

These were the updates on the US, Israel, Iran war for Friday, March 20.

  • President Donald Trump assails NATO ⁠over what he views as a lack of support for the US-Israel war against Iran, describing Washington’s traditional allies as “cowards”.
  • The Iranian Red Crescent says at least 204 children have been killed as the overall death toll in Iran exceeds 1,444 people. More than 1,000 people have been killed in Israeli attacks on Lebanon.
  • Iran’s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ps spokesperson, General Ali Mohammad Naini, has been killed in what Israel says was an overnight air attack. Iranian General Esmail Ahmadi, head of intelligence for the Basij forces, has also been killed.
  • Millions of Muslims across the Middle East celebrate Eid al-Fitr, while Iran also marks Nowruz under the violence of war.

    Here’s what happened today

    This live page will be closing soon, but our coverage will continue on a new page.

    Here are some of today’s top events:

    • US President Donald Trump has said he doesn’t want a ceasefire in Iran, before saying in a post on his Truth Social platform that the US is “very close” to meeting its objectives in Iran and is considering “winding down” military action.
    • Israel’s military has claimed it assassinated two more high-ranking Iranian officials earlier this week, identifying them as Esmail Ahmadi, intelligence chief of the Basij force, and Mehdi Rostami Shamastan, a senior Intelligence Ministry official.
    • At least 20 people were killed and 57 wounded in the latest Israeli attacks on Lebanon, the Lebanese Disaster Risk Management Unit says, bringing the total number killed since March 2 to 1,021.
    • Drones struck Kuwait’s largest oil refinery, the Mina Al-Ahmadi refinery, for the second day as Iran continued a sweeping assault on energy infrastructure across the Gulf, causing a fire in the facility.
    • A US logistics support camp near Baghdad international airport has been hit with successive attacks, an Iraqi security source has told Al Jazeera.
    • NATO has temporarily pulled all personnel from its mission in Iraq and relocated them to a command centre in Naples, Italy, as fallout from the Israeli-US war on Iran raises regional security concerns.

    US says it will temporarily lift sanctions on oil from Iran for 30 days

    The US Treasury Department has said it is removing its own sanctions on Iranian crude oil and petroleum products for 30 days, as the US-Israeli war on Iran continues to cause oil price and supply shocks around the world.

    US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ent said the temporary authorisation only applies to sanctioned oil that was already in transit and not to new orders.

    Iran has been attacking ships that it says are linked to the US and Israel, preventing shipments of oil and gas from transiting the Strait of Hormuz, causing price shocks around the world and fears of broader economic consequences for the global economy.

    Iranian officials envision new post-war regional order

    By Ali Hashem

    Reporting from Tehran, Iran

    Iranian officials have a vision of a new regional order after this war. We saw this alluded to not just in Iranian President Pezeshkian’s Nowruz message today, but also in comments by Iran’s foreign minister and parliament speaker.

    The Iranians think after this war ends, there should be a new regional system and that this system should be managed by regional states, without any intervention from international players or superpowers, mainly the United States.

    Iran threatens ‘tourist destinations’ as US-Israel war enters week 3

    Iran has threatened to expand its retaliatory attacks to include recreational and tourist sites worldwide.

    Iran’s top military spokesman, General Abolfazl Shekarchi, warned that “parks, recreational areas and tourist destinations” worldwide won’t be safe for the country’s enemies.

    The threat renewed concerns that Iran may revert to using asymmetric attacks beyond the Middle East as a pressure tactic.

    Iran has stepped up its attacks on energy sites in Gulf Arab states after Israel bombed Iran’s massive South Pars offshore natural gasfield earlier in the week.

    Two waves of Iranian drones attacked a Kuwaiti oil refinery early Friday, sparking a fire. The Mina Al-Ahmadi refinery, which can process some 730,000 barrels of oil per day, is one of the largest in the Middle East.

    Panama Canal operating at top capacity as Iran war boosts demand

    The ⁠Panama ⁠Canal is operating at top capacity with demand increasing for the passage of liquefied natural gas (LNG) tankers amid the impacts of the war on Iran, the waterway’s chief Ricaurte Vasquez told reporters.

    He said the canal is seeing between 36 and 38 ⁠vessels pass each day.

    Vasquez said it’s preparing to offer one slot a day for LNG tankers to pass through the canal, a significant boost from the four per month preceding the war.

    Trump trying to ‘bully allies into cooperation’

    By John Hendren

    Reporting from Washington, DC

    President Trump has gone on a tear against NATO and the European allies. Speaking to reporters outside the White House earlier, he said the UK didn’t act quickly enough in letting the US use its military bases.

    He went on to criticise Europe, Australia, Japan and South Korea for not doing enough in his view to help out by sending ships to keep the Strait of Hormuz open.

    What he apparently wants is some kind of big military operation because the US military is largely otherwise occupied. But one of the problems he runs into is that he didn’t warn most of these countries that the US was going to get into the war alongside Israel.

    He said he wanted the “surprise” factor. Well, he got surprise, but what he didn’t get was cooperation. Now, Trump is attacking the US allies and trying to bully them into cooperation. Perhaps that contributed to the fact that the UK finally agreed to let the US use its bases, but of course, that didn’t satisfy Trump either. 

    This is Trump versus his allies in the middle of a war.

    Iran says it has no surplus oil to offer global markets

    Iran says it has no surplus crude oil to offer to international markets after US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ent said Washington could lift sanctions on Iranian oil at sea.

    “Currently, Iran basically has no surplus crude oil left on the water or for supply in other international markets, and the US Treasury secretary’s statement is solely aimed at giving hope to buyers,” Oil Ministry spokesman Saman Ghoddoosi wrote in a post on social media.

    Iran vows to hit UAE’s Ras al-Khaimah if attacks launched again

    Iran’s military has warned it will target the UAE’s Ras al-Khaimah if Iranian Gulf islands are attacked again from there.

    “We warn the United Arab Emirates, in case of repeated encroachment from the source of that country to the Iranian islands … in the Persian Gulf, the powerful Iranian armed forces will put Ras al-Khaimah … under their crushing blows,” its spokesperson said in a statement carried by Iran’s Tasnim news agency.

    The islands are located near the Strait of Hormuz, a globally vital shipping lane through which roughly one-fifth of the world’s oil and gas passes.

    The UAE government announced earlier this month that a drone had been successfully intercepted by air defence systems, causing debris to fall in the al-Hamra village area in Ras al-Khaimah.
